What are the functions of coenzyme capsules?

Coenzyme capsules are used in the treatment of many diseases. This type of capsule mainly plays an auxiliary role in clinical practice and is more effective for some cardiovascular diseases. Although coenzyme capsules are widely used, they are not suitable for all diseases, and the dosage is also very particular. They are mainly used as auxiliary treatments for certain diseases. So what are the functions of coenzyme capsules?

1. Effects on the heart

Improve cell vitality and activate the power of the heart. The human body's daily requirement for coenzyme Q10 is 30 mg, and the heart has the highest requirement for coenzyme Q10, more than twice that of other organs. Coenzyme Q10 can increase cellular oxygen carrying capacity, increase cardiac contractility, enhance heart beat power, improve myocardial blood supply, and prevent damage to myocardial cells, thereby improving heart symptoms. It is especially suitable for patients with arrhythmia, myocardial infarction, myocardial ischemia, angina pectoris, myocarditis, ischemic myocardial infarction, heart failure, and after heart surgery.

2. Effects on the skin

Strengthen cell metabolism and effectively prevent skin aging. After people are over 30 years old, the coenzyme Q10 in the skin's epidermis begins to decline significantly and wrinkles begin to appear. Supplementing with coenzyme Q10 can brighten skin tone, whiten and lighten spots, shrink and moisturize, prevent wrinkles and anti-aging, thereby achieving the effect of beauty and skin care.

3. Effects on the liver

Coenzyme Q10 is known as the protector of the liver. The liver is the largest detoxification organ in the human body. Coenzyme Q10 can increase the antioxidant activity of liver tissue, enhance the liver's ability to scavenge free radicals, and also has a certain effect on the repair of liver cells, the synthesis of liver glycogen and the liver's detoxification ability.
